      <description>&lt;P&gt;We are getting Null and 0 values returned when accessing some metrics like com.dynatrace.builtin:app.jserrorsduringuseractions in the timeseries API. Is this because the "action", in this case was not seen during, the polling period, so no value is recorded, rather than the "action" happening and 0 errors being seen?&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Null within the timeseries API means 'no data'. In case of errorcounts a zero means that we observed some user actions during that minute and none of those had an error attached. So the result is '0'. On the other hand if we do not see any user action within a timeframe we do state 'null' as no data available for that timeframe.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In case of the metric 'com.dynatrace.builtin:app.useractions' that seems a bit strange I agree as the value '0' can't happen. Either we observe a user action then the value is above zero or we do not observe any then the value is 'null'. &lt;/P&gt;</description>
